INDIAN BANK Chanubanda Branch IFSC Code
The IFSC code of INDIAN BANK Chanubanda branch located in KRISHNA, ANDHRA PRADESH is IDIB000C051 .
| Bank | INDIAN BANK |
|---|---|
| Branch | CHANUBANDA |
| IFSC | IDIB000C051 |
| Address | Door No 2/2 Lakshmi Prasad Nilayam Main Road Chanubanda Chanubanda Pin 521214 |
| City | CHANUBANDA |
| District | KRISHNA |
| State | ANDHRA PRADESH |
| Phone | 255226 |

Structure of IFSC Code
An IFSC code consists of 11 characters. The first 4 characters represent the bank, the 5th character is always zero, and the last 6 characters represent the branch.
